[0023] The present invention will be described in further detail below in conjunction with the accompanying drawings.
[0024] See figure 1 The self-luminous display 100 provided by the embodiment of the present invention includes a substrate 10 , a plurality of self-luminous pixels 20 and an encapsulation layer 30 , wherein the plurality of self-luminous pixels 20 are arranged in a matrix on the substrate 10 .
[0025] Preferably, the substrate 10 is a transparent substrate. In this embodiment, the material of the substrate 10 is PET (polyethylene terephthalate).
[0026] Each pixel 20 includes a red light emitting element 21 , a green light emitting element 22 and a blue light emitting element 23 . Wherein, each light-emitting element includes a first electrode 24 and a second electrode 25 oppositely arranged on the substrate 10, and a semiconductor nanowire having a P-N junction is overlapped between the first electrode 24 and the second electrode 25 26.
